We’re looking for an AI Solutions Technical Engineering Manager to lead the delivery of AI- and data-enabled products and platforms from early shaping through to measurable outcomes in production. You’ll operate at the intersection of engineering leadership, AI delivery, and stakeholder alignment, turning ambiguous ideas into structured plans, unblocking teams, and ensuring solutions are operationally viable.
You will work across domain teams in a federated model, bringing clarity around ownership, interfaces, and accountability. This is a senior role for someone who can drive innovation while delivering under tight timelines and high expectations.
The role
- Own delivery of AI workloads and AI-enabled products end-to-end: from discovery through build, launch, and iteration.
- Convert loosely defined ideas into delivery plans, milestones, and measurable outcomes.
- Lead engineering execution across multiple teams, ensuring clear ownership boundaries, interfaces, and ways of working.
- Drive pragmatic technical direction across AI systems: LLM/ML deployment patterns, model lifecycle, monitoring, and iteration.
- Ensure production readiness: security, reliability, observability, governance, and cost awareness (FinOps mindset).
- Unblock teams through active problem-solving, dependency management, and escalation when needed.
- Balance trade-offs across speed, quality, risk, and cost and communicate them clearly.
- Manage stakeholder expectations with calm, credible leadership; run steering conversations and provide transparent updates.
- Build a culture of continuous improvement and innovation, with disciplined delivery under strict timelines.
What success looks like
- AI solutions move from idea to production with demonstrable business value.
- Delivery stays outcome-focused despite technical uncertainty and complexity.
- AI capabilities are operationally viable: monitored, reliable, secure, and cost-controlled.
- Teams understand ownership and interfaces; dependencies don’t derail execution.
- Stakeholders trust progress, decisions, and trade-offs even under pressure.
Experience and capabilities (essential)
- Proven experience leading engineering delivery for data-heavy, AI-enabled, or platform products.
- Strong understanding of modern AI concepts: ML systems, LLMs, data dependencies, evaluation, and operational risks.
- Track record managing complex deliveries across multiple teams and stakeholders.
- Comfortable operating in federated/domain-oriented environments with shared ownership.
- Excellent communication: able to align senior stakeholders and guide teams through ambiguity.
- Solid grasp of production engineering fundamentals: cloud, reliability, security, monitoring, CI/CD.
Technical environment
- Cloud: AWS / Azure / GCP.
- AI/ML delivery: model deployment, MLOps/LLMOps, monitoring, iteration.
- Platform foundations: Kubernetes (EKS/AKS), CI/CD, GitOps concepts.
- Observability: metrics, logs, tracing; dashboards and alerting disciplines.
- Architecture: APIs, microservices, event-driven systems; data pipelines.
Desirable
- Experience delivering AI in regulated or high-stakes environments (e.g., financial services).
- Familiarity with AI governance, ethics, and emerging regulation (e.g., EU AI Act).
- Exposure to LLM platforms (e.g., Bedrock / Foundry) and multi-tenant cost controls.
